EDFA 1550 is a special  tool used  in fiber optic systems. These systems help  send information, like internet data or phone calls, over long distances using light. The EDFA, which  stands for  Erbium-Doped  Fiber Amplifier, makes the  light signal stronger so it can travel farther without losing quality. When you decide to pick the right EDFA 1550 for your fiber optic needs, there are  a few things to think about. First, you need to know how much power you need. Different systems require different levels of power. For example, if you have a small office that just needs internet, a lower power EDFA might be fine. But, if you are running a big data  center that sends a lot of information, you will need a  more powerful model. Also, consider  the distance your signal  needs to travel. Longer distances might need a stronger EDFA to keep the signal clear and strong. You  should also look at the gain, which is how much  the amplifier boosts the signal. Higher gain means a stronger signal, but you also need to  make sure it fits well with your  existing setup. EDFA 1550, or Erbium-Doped Fiber Amplifier at 1550 nm, is an  important tool in fiber optic communication. It helps  to make signals stronger so they can travel long distances without getting weak. However, sometimes users face  issues when using EDFA 1550 units. One common  problem is  signal distortion. This can happen when the signals coming  into the EDFA are too strong or too weak. When this occurs, the output signal may not  be clear, which can make it hard to understand the information being sent. To fix this,  you should always check the input power levels. Make sure they are within  the  recommended range. If you notice distortion, adjusting the input power can  help  improve the signal  quality.

Another  issue is  noise. Noise is unwanted signals that can mess  up  the information we want to receive. This is especially  a problem when there are many signals trying to  pass through the same fiber at the same  time. To reduce  noise, you can use filters before the EDFA. These  filters help  to  remove  unwanted  signals and make the main signal clearer. Additionally, ensuring that your  fiber optic  cables are in good condition can help  reduce noise. Lastly, users may  experience  power  fluctuations. This means that the strength of the signal can  change unexpectedly. Power fluctuations can be  caused by changes in temperature or by other devices in  the area. To solve this, it’s  important to have a stable power supply for  your  EDFA. Also, keeping the EDFA in a controlled  environment where  the temperature does not change  too much can help  maintain consistent performance. By being  aware of these common issues  and  knowing  how  to resolve them, users can  get the best performance from  their EDFA 1550 units.
